Anna Estevao, a criminal defense attorney known for her role in Sean 'Diddy' Combs' recent trial, has joined the legal team representing Nicolás Maduro, the ousted president of Venezuela, in a federal case in New York. Maduro and his wife, Cilia Flores, have been detained for over 150 days on charges including drug trafficking and money laundering. The legal proceedings have seen both advancements and setbacks, particularly regarding access to evidence and legal funding. The next court hearing is scheduled for June 30, allowing both sides time to prepare their arguments.
